Overview of Navigator Hldgs Ltd (NVGS)

Navigator Hldgs Ltd is a maritime transportation specialist that owns and operates the world’s largest fleet of handysize liquefied gas carriers. With a fleet designed for the efficient transport of liquefied petroleum gas (LPG), petrochemical gases such as ethylene and ethane, and ammonia, the company maintains a critical role in the global energy supply chain. Leveraging advanced vessel technology and diversified operational capabilities, Navigator Hldgs Ltd offers seamless seaborne transportation that supports energy companies, industrial users, and commodity traders.

Business Model and Core Operations

The company’s core business revolves around owning and operating modern, semi- or fully-refrigerated liquefied gas carriers, which are configured to transport gases in liquefied form under controlled conditions. By effectively reducing the volume of gases up to 900 times, the firm provides a cost-efficient alternative to traditional transportation methods. Its fleet of handysize carriers is particularly suited for short and medium haul routes where infrastructure limitations prevent the deployment of larger vessels. This adaptability enables the company to service a wide range of ports and satisfy diverse customer requirements.

Integrated Terminal Investment

Navigator Hldgs Ltd also holds a 50% stake in an ethylene export marine terminal located at Morgan’s Point, Texas, on the Houston Ship Channel. This strategic joint venture, often referred to as the Ethylene Export Terminal, facilitates the efficient export of ethylene and petrochemical gases, positioning the company as an integrated player in both maritime transport and terminal operations. The terminal enhances operational synergies by enabling higher throughput and supporting a robust network for gas exports.
